1. Pre-Stage Structural Docking Infrastructure
Maneuvering anxiety escalates rapidly if the helm operator is forced to calculate crosswinds while the crew scrambles to locate lines or adjust bumpers. Complete 100% of your physical configurations in open water well before your hull enters the marina breakwaters or fuel dock perimeter.
- Fender Staging Geometry: Hang heavy-duty marine fenders along your primary boarding beam. Position them precisely at the height of the target pier, floating dock, or structural slip pilings.
- Mooring Line Alignment: Cleat your bow, stern, and spring lines early, flaking the remaining rope neatly on deck so they can be passed smoothly to dock hands without knotting.
- The Absolute Step-Off Mandate: Explicitly instruct your crew that no passenger is permitted to leap or lunge from a moving vessel onto a wet dock walkway. A slow, controlled "miss" allows the captain to reverse cleanly and re-align the approach vector; a rushed leap poses an immediate, severe safety hazard between a multi-ton hull and a concrete bulkhead.
2. Execute Open-Water "Idle-Only" Transition Drills
Before committing your hull to a confined slip layout, navigate to an open pocket of water to recalibrate your touch on the remote binnacle control. Modern high-end dayboats and pontoons respond immediately to subtle propulsion changes, meaning small, metered inputs are vastly more effective than sustained acceleration.
- The Drift and Wind-Vector Analysis: Bring the vessel to a complete stop in open water to calculate real-time wind drift and current vectors against your superstructure.
- Pulse Throttle Management: Practice moving the boat utilizing short, brief clicks of power—engaging the gear into forward idle for one to two seconds, then instantly returning to neutral. Allowing the vessel's existing hydrodynamic momentum to execute the rotation prevents over-correction, stabilizes your approach line, and keeps your decisions calm. Docking is fundamentally an exercise in managed drifting, not sustained velocity.
3. Establish Single-Commander Crew Protocols
A disorganized crew offering conflicting spatial estimates or shouting directions can completely disrupt a captain's focus during close-quarters berthing.
- Assign Explicit Responsibilities: Designate a single, alert crew member to handle the primary bow line and another to secure the stern. Instruct all other passengers to remain securely seated in their assigned zones to maintain a level running attitude and keep lines of sight completely unobstructed.
- Pinch Point Awareness: Warn your guests never to place their hands, arms, or feet between the gunwale and the dock structure to check momentum. Utilize the boat's mechanical reverse thrust to arrest forward speed, keeping limbs completely clear of high-pressure pinch points.
4. Implement a Strict "Abort and Reset" Operational Rule
There is zero penalty for abandoning a compromised approach line on a windy North Texas afternoon. If a sudden crosswind gust or a heavy displacement wake from a passing watercraft pushes your bow off its targeted entry axis, immediately abort the maneuver.
- Clear the Obstruction: Do not attempt to save a poor angle by applying heavy forward throttle near a bulkhead. Shift cleanly into reverse, back out into open water, and re-align your approach vector. A controlled, calm reset is the definitive mark of professional seamanship.
5. Differentiate Seamanship Errors from Mechanical Liabilities
If your hull consistently pulls unpredictably, or if shifting your binnacle controls between forward, neutral, and reverse requires excessive physical effort, you are likely fighting an equipment deficiency rather than a lack of environmental skill.
- Control Linkage Synchronization: Over the winter months, marine steering fluids can contract and develop internal air pockets, and mechanical shift cables can stretch or bind inside their support tubes. Verify that your helm responses are immediate, smooth, and predictable lock-to-lock.

Technical Frequently Asked Questions
What is the primary reason intermediate boaters struggle with low-speed dock approaches?
Maneuvering failures are almost universally caused by carrying too much forward momentum and failing to utilize neutral coasting. Operating the throttle continuously rather than pulsing the gear detents forces the hull into sudden acceleration cycles that override steering control.
Should I dock my watercraft bow-first or stern-first?
The optimal entry angle is dictated entirely by local wind velocity, current direction, and your specific slip configuration. The safest protocol is always attempting to dock heading into the prevailing environmental force, as this provides maximum braking capability and steering responsiveness from your propulsion system.
